AUSTINTOWN, Ohio - There will be a new place for kids to cool off in Austintown this summer.
The township park will open a specially designed splash pad for the warm weather. In order to conserve, the splash pad will use low water pressure.
"This has 16 sprinklers that cre coming out of the ground spraying water, and there are four above-the-ground feathers that are either dumping water or spraying water in to the air," says Todd Schaffer of Austintown Township Parks.
For safety purposes, the surface of the pad will be covered with a padded rubberized material. A ribbon cutting for the official opening is set for May 22 at 10 a.m.
